Men's insulated jackets sit at the heart of a serious cold-weather wardrobe — the piece that handles the conditions when a fleece isn't enough and a heavier parka is more than needed. The selection focuses on the down and synthetic options that perform across the most common cold-weather scenarios.
Down insulation
Patagonia's Down Sweater and similar down jackets are our most-recommended down pieces — exceptional warmth-to-weight, compressibility for travel, and the kind of construction that lasts decades when kept dry. Down performs best in genuinely cold and dry conditions; it's worth the investment for travelers, commuters in dry-cold climates, and anyone wanting maximum warmth for minimal weight.
Synthetic insulation
Patagonia's Nano Puff and similar synthetic-insulated jackets are the more versatile choice for unpredictable weather. Synthetic insulation holds its warmth when wet — meaning the jacket continues to perform in damp conditions where down would underperform. A better pick for wet climates, active use, and anywhere weather is unpredictable.
Hybrid construction
Several jackets in the lineup blend down and synthetic — down in the core for warmth, synthetic in the shoulders and arms where the jacket is more likely to get wet. A genuinely thoughtful design approach worth understanding before buying.
How to choose
Match insulation type to your actual conditions. Down for dry cold and travel; synthetic for wet, active, or unpredictable use. Both perform well as standalone outerwear in milder cold or as midlayers under a shell.
